If you want to monetize your game or app, this engine is right for you!

Smart IAP is simple yet powerful micro-transaction engine for GameMaker projects.

With few smart scripts you can create, purchase, consume and check state of every IAP product in your game.

If you need help with implementing engine or setting strore, just contac us. Use the "Contact publisher" form at top of the page.

Simple lifecycle:

  1. a) Initialize IAP b) Create product/s c) Activate IAP
  2. Buy product
  3. Consume/Use product


  • logging of all IAP events
  • easy to understand documentation
  • manual for setting IAP in Google Store
  • link to android demo included
  • links to game projects which implements this engine

Fail-safe features prevents your games from:

  • interrupted transactions due to application crashes
  • user trying to buy already owned product
  • application trying to consume product not owned
  • etc

LINK to an old gmc forum webpage

End User Licence Agreement (EULA).

Version 1.2.1. Published January 7, 2016

Created with GameMaker: Studio v1.4.1567

Age Rating: 4+

Average Rating

This asset hasn't received enough reviews yet.

Your review

You can only review assets you've bought.

No reviews yet

No reviews have been left for this asset - be the first!

Package contents

Loading, please wait

What is the issue?

Back to Top